Understanding Deductibles and Their Role in Your Homeowners Policy What Exactly Is a Deductible?
A deductible is the quantity of cost you’re answerable for paying out-of-pocket previously your coverage kicks in to cover losses. For occasion, you probably have a deductible of $1,000 on your policy and suffer destroy valued at $10,000 from a covered peril (like fireplace or robbery), you could pay the first $1,000 your self. The insurance coverage business might then pay the closing $nine,000.
Types of Deductibles Fixed Dollar Deductibles
This sort consists of a fixed dollar amount that possible pay when filing a declare—like our outdated example of $1,000.
Percentage Deductibles
This is calculated as a percent of your property’s insured value. For example, if your own home is insured for $300,000 and you have a 2% deductible, you'd be liable for the 1st $6,000 of any declare.
Why Are Deductibles Important?
Understanding deductibles facilitates house owners manipulate their financial menace. A decrease deductible potential you'll be able to pay much less out-of-pocket while filing a declare; having said that, this oftentimes outcomes in larger charges. Conversely, deciding upon a top deductible can cut down your per 30 days repayments yet would depart you bearing greater economic accountability in the time of claims.
